This archive report was first published on 26 September 2019.

On September 26, 2019, the Uganda Cranes coaching position was left vacant, with no Ugandan applicants among the 67 coaches who expressed interest in the role.

According to reports, the general sentiment among Ugandan coaches was that they did not stand a chance against foreign applicants, highlighting a perceived lack of confidence in the country's football talent.
